Transaction 1529163133ee2c49098f99bcb52e767578876b3d7267ecfb6d8e183708135f89
1 Input
1 Output
-
1529163133ee2c49098f99bcb52e767578876b3d7267ecfb6d8e183708135f89:0
- value
- 997529
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 9904d39a1850ffe20d49583607219277e93c5838f7d8abb2bc2014c94ea21c80
- address
- tb1pnyzd8xsc2rl7yr2ftqmqwgvjwl5nckpc7lv2hv4uyq2vjn4zrjqqe4t20d